帮忙顶,不用spring那东西。

解决方案 »

  1.   

    我用的时候一般在action里面看不到DAO,action只和service交互
      

  2.   

    一般是这样的,在DAO层里的程序一般是对一个表的增删改查,而SERVICE层里的程序是针对业务逻辑,有时可能需要调用几个DAO。
    我是这样认为的,如果在service里,同时对几个表的DAO进行操作,并且需要加事务处理,那就需要用service,如果只对一个表进行操作,不需要加事务处理,就可以直接把DAO注入到action里。灵活掌握,不必拘于一格
      

  3.   

    这是一个结构层次的问题,看业务量,
    业务复杂多变,放在service里;
    如果业务简单,直接放在action里。